*/ published struct InputSource { /** contains the byte input stream of the document. */ com::sun::star::io::XInputStream aInputStream; //------------------------------------------------------------------------- /** contains the encoding of the data stream. This is used by the parser to do unicode conversions.

Note that in general you do not need to specify an encoding. Either it is UTF-8 or UTF-16 which is recognized by the parser or it is specified in the first line of the XML-File ( e.g. ?xml encoding="EUC-JP"? ).

*/ string sEncoding; //------------------------------------------------------------------------- /** constains the public Id of the document, for example, needed in exception-message strings. */ string sPublicId; //------------------------------------------------------------------------- /** contains the sytemID of the document. */ string sSystemId; }; //============================================================================= }; }; }; }; }; #endif
